Browse Source

静态页面

1002884655 4 years ago
parent
commit
58a32b070c
3 changed files with 13 additions and 2 deletions
  1. 3
    1
      src/pages/index/DaLeTouDingDan/index.vue
  2. 5
    0
      src/store/user/index.js
  3. 5
    1
      src/util/Api.js

+ 3
- 1
src/pages/index/DaLeTouDingDan/index.vue View File

148
     ]),
148
     ]),
149
     ...mapUserActions([
149
     ...mapUserActions([
150
       'PostBetting',
150
       'PostBetting',
151
-      'GetStoreList'
151
+      'GetStoreList',
152
+      'CreateAliPayOrder'
152
     ]),
153
     ]),
153
     SelectStore (item) { // 选择店铺
154
     SelectStore (item) { // 选择店铺
154
       if (this.DataLock) return
155
       if (this.DataLock) return
197
         this.TotalPrize = 0
198
         this.TotalPrize = 0
198
         this.Multiple = 1
199
         this.Multiple = 1
199
         this.DataLock = false
200
         this.DataLock = false
201
+        window.location.href = `/api/app/order/alipay/buylottery?orderId=${res.data.data.orderId}&returlURL=${`www.baidu.com`}`
200
       }).catch((res) => {
202
       }).catch((res) => {
201
         this.Toast(res.data.message)
203
         this.Toast(res.data.message)
202
         this.DataLock = false
204
         this.DataLock = false

+ 5
- 0
src/store/user/index.js View File

114
     }
114
     }
115
   },
115
   },
116
   actions: {
116
   actions: {
117
+    CreateAliPayOrder (context, payload) { // 创建支付宝订单
118
+      return new Promise((resolve, reject) => {
119
+        ToolClass.Axios(resolve, reject, Api.CreateAliPayOrder, context, payload, 1000)
120
+      })
121
+    },
117
     ImgUpload (context, payload) { // 上传图片
122
     ImgUpload (context, payload) { // 上传图片
118
       return new Promise((resolve, reject) => {
123
       return new Promise((resolve, reject) => {
119
         ToolClass.Axios(resolve, reject, Api.ImgUpload, context, payload, 1000)
124
         ToolClass.Axios(resolve, reject, Api.ImgUpload, context, payload, 1000)

+ 5
- 1
src/util/Api.js View File

2
 const prefix = process.env.NODE_ENV === 'production' ? '' : '/api'
2
 const prefix = process.env.NODE_ENV === 'production' ? '' : '/api'
3
 
3
 
4
 const $api = {
4
 const $api = {
5
+  CreateAliPayOrder: { // 创建支付宝订单
6
+    method: 'get',
7
+    url: `${prefix}/app/order/alipay/buylottery`
8
+  },
5
   SignIn: { // 登录
9
   SignIn: { // 登录
6
     method: 'post',
10
     method: 'post',
7
     url: `${prefix}/app/login`
11
     url: `${prefix}/app/login`
8
   },
12
   },
9
   GetBanner: { // 获取banner
13
   GetBanner: { // 获取banner
10
     method: 'get',
14
     method: 'get',
11
-    url: `${prefix}/app/ad`
15
+    url: `${prefix}/app/banner`
12
   },
16
   },
13
   GetFootballKeys: { // 获取足彩相关字典
17
   GetFootballKeys: { // 获取足彩相关字典
14
     method: 'get',
18
     method: 'get',